The Forma Adventure HDRY boots are full leather lightweight boot that offers CE level protection, but is far more flexible and comfortable on and off the bike than traditional more narrow focused off-road boots. The lightweight construction increases rider agility and comfort, and have become the most popular adventure boots for everyday touring and trail adventures. These are a best-selling adventure boot around the world.

Features;
- Certified protection according to EN 13634:2017 Level 2-2-2-2
- Full-grain oiled leather
- Drytex® waterproof
- Lightweight construction
- Adventure lug sole
- Ankle Malleolus TPU
- Steel shank
- Injection molded shin plate
- PU Shifter pad
- Velcro® + 3 Strap closure system
- GH® Buckles
- Reinforced Heel and Toe
- Technical insole
- European production
- Extra Comfort Fit-wide
Outer;
- Full grain oil treated leather upper
- Specific adventure/enduro/atv-quad double density rubber sole
- Injection moulded plastic protections
- Gear pad protection
- Adjustable velcro closure
- Replaceable/adjustable GH plastic buckles
Inner;
- Personalised Forma Drytex lining (waterproof & breathable)
- Shin and ankle TPU moulded plastic protections
- Soft polymer padding with memory foam
- Special stiff Dual Flex nylon with anti-shock felt midsole
